This episode of the Howard Jarvis Radio Show is a must-listen for anyone concerned about the impact of taxes and voter integrity on their wallet. Join Susan Shelley and Jon Coupal, President of the Howard Jarvis Taxpayers Association, as they discuss the latest developments in California's tax landscape and the importance of protecting taxpayer rights.

The conversation covers a range of topics, from the proposed wealth tax to the need for voter ID and the potential consequences of not having a secure voting system. The hosts also delve into the complexities of the ballot measures, including Prop 43, which aims to make it harder to raise taxes, and Prop 40, the wealth tax that has sparked controversy among Californians.
